Paytm shares drop 3% after govt shields UPI payments only up to Rs 2,000 from charges. Should you buy the dip?

Paytm shares fell after the government directed banks and payment providers not to charge for UPI transactions up to Rs 2,000, raising uncertainty over charges for higher-value transactions. The decline came a day after Paytm hit a fresh 52-week high of Rs 1,840, with the stock having nearly doubled from its March low of Rs 930.6.
